Pride Trier 2025: A summer full of colors and diversity!

The celebrations surrounding Pride Month in Trier will also reach their climax in July 2025. Even though June has already passed, people can look forward to a variety of queer-friendly events in July. Under the motto “Our Pride Fights for Rights”, the organizers are sending a strong signal for equality, diversity and human dignity. The activities end with a big CSD event on July 19th, which delights with a colorful parade and an inspiring stage program.

A real highlight of July is the open air karaoke in the Queergarten, which will take place every Wednesday evening (July 9th, 16th, 23rd and 30th) from 6 p.m. to 10 p.m. Only two euros participation fee is required, which will be offset against the drinks bill. DJ Carnage will support the event with his music and ensure an exuberant atmosphere, as Volksfreund reports.

Diverse supporting program

Film fans will also get their money's worth. On July 8th, the Trier Queer Cultural Center will show the film “The Birdcage – A Paradise for Shrill Birds”. Tickets can be purchased via Broadway Trier. For anyone who wants to test their knowledge about the LGBTQ+ community, the Fairweg Quiz – Pride Edition takes place in the Queergarten, and entry is free. Whoever wins can look forward to regional prizes!

Another important date is the FLINTA* party at SCHMIT-Z on July 12th from 10 p.m., to which only FLINTA* people (women, lesbians, inter*, non-binary, trans*, agender) have access. Admission is 10 euros and the celebration promises a colorful get-together. The preliminary events, such as memorial events and lectures on queer hostility and HIV prevention, also ensure that the topics are illuminated in a comprehensive manner.

Big CSD event and party atmosphere

On July 19th, the big CSD will take place in Trier, which starts at 12:30 p.m. at the Porta Nigra and ends in the Queergarten. The Pride Village will open in the palace gardens at 2 p.m. with a colorful stage program and numerous information stands. The Glow Party at Mergener Hof, which starts at 10:30 p.m., creates a party atmosphere. In order to be accessible to everyone, there are different ticket options: The special pride ticket for 20 euros, the normal ticket for 15 euros and a reduced ticket for 13 euros, each including a welcome shot.

For those who want to celebrate in a more relaxed way, there will also be an unofficial Pride party at Puzzles Pub & Night Café on the same evening from 9 p.m. Admission is free and ensures a cozy, family atmosphere.
